Next I downloaded sdcard-rockos-20250729-015830.img.zst
from here https://fast-mirror.isrc.ac.cn/rockos/images/generic/latest/
The server was real slow.
I then unzstd sdcard-rockos-20250729-015830.img.zst
(won’t work with normal zip program, must use unzstd)
I got sdcard-rockos-20250729-015830.img
I used create startup disc again (you have to pull down the type selector from cdrom to drive image) Be careful that you have selected your proper destination drive!
Inserted the drive and booted… there was a bootloader in the computer flash already.
